Constitution does not force citizens to choose between rights or culture, we must accommodate one another: CJI DY Chandrachud

The CJI urged citizens to uphold the idea of unity in diversity by being more accommodating towards one another, citing the Constitution's accommodation principle.

Chief Justice of India DY Chandrachud on Saturday said that the Indian Constitution does not force its citizens to choose between rights or culture.
